Frequently Asked Questions

When was Bob McHale born?

Bob McHale was born on February 7, 1870.

Where was Bob McHale born?

Bob McHale was born in Sacramento, CA.

How tall was Bob McHale?

Bob McHale was 5-11 (180 cm) tall.

How much did Bob McHale weigh when playing?

Bob McHale weighed 152 lbs (68 kg) when playing.

How many seasons did Bob McHale play?

Bob McHale played 1 season.

Is Bob McHale in the Hall of Fame?

Bob McHale has not been elected into the Hall of Fame.

What position did Bob McHale play?

Bob McHale was a Centerfielder, Shortstop and First Baseman.

How many hits did Bob McHale have?

Bob McHale had 6 hits over his career.

How many home runs did Bob McHale have?

Bob McHale had 0 home runs over his career.

What was Bob McHale's average?

Bob McHale had a .182 average over his career.

How many teams has Bob McHale played for?

Bob McHale played for 1 team, the Washington Senators.

When did Bob McHale retire?

Bob McHale last played in 1898.

What are Bob McHale's nicknames?

Rabbit is a nickname for Bob McHale.
